How Our Same Day Water Removal Process Works

We know that water damage can be a nightmare, but our team is here to make it as painless as possible. Our process is designed to get your property dry and safe as quickly as possible. We’ll start by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the water. From there, we’ll use our specialized equipment to extract the water and dry your property. Our technicians are IICRC-certified and trained to handle even the toughest water damage jobs.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ll arrive at your property and assess the damage,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. We’ll then create a customized plan to get your property dry and safe as quickly as possible.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the standing water from your property. This is usually the fastest part of the process, and we’ll work as quickly as possible to get your property dry.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your property and remove any remaining moisture. This is an important step, as it hel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old and mildew.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ll clean and sanitize your property to remove any remaining dirt, debris, and bacteria. This is an important step in preventing the growth of mold and mildew.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once your property is dry and clean, we’ll work with you to restore and reconstruct any damaged areas. This may include repairing or replacing drywall, flooring, and other damaged materials.

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to bigger problems down the line. Here are some common signs to watch out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. If you notice a musty smell in your home,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a larger problem.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s time to investigate further.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show that your floor has been damaged by water. If you notice this, it’s time to call us.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can show that you have a water damage problem.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ate further.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age can be a sign of a larger problem. If you notice water damage on your property, it’s time to call us.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els can show that your property is at risk of mold and mildew growth. If you notice high humidity levels, it’s time to call us.

Same Day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
You have a small water spill in your kitchen. Yes No You can likely handle this yourself with some towels and a mop.
You have a large water spill in your basement. No Yes This is a bigger job that needs specialized equipment and expertise.
You notice a musty odor in your home. No Yes This could show the presence of mold and mildew, which needs professional attention.
You have a burst pipe in your home. No Yes This is an emergency situation that needs immediate attention from a professional.
You notice water stains on your ceiling. No Yes This could show a larger problem with your roof or plumbing system.
You have a small leak under your sink. Yes No You can likely handle this yourself with some basic plumbing knowledge and tools.

Same Day Water Removal Cost In Town and Country, WA

The cost of Same Day Water Removal in Town and Country, WA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common water damage jobs: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ed
Emergency Response $100 – $500 Time of day, severity of damage
Inspections and Testing $100 – $500 Frequency and type of testing needed
